Menu Magazine
This beloved family-owned grocery store was a pioneer when it began publishing its own menu magazine offering not only recipes using in-house branded products, but feature stories on local growers, as well as seasonal inspiration and table decor.
Early in my career I was lucky to work with a talented team on a number of feature spreads, conceiving the overall look and feel and designing layouts.

Menu Magazine, Holiday 2005 Issue
I was obsessed with jewel-toned brocaded fabrics at the time (still am) and wanted to bring that richness to the holiday page spreads. And to further embellish the layout, we added small gemstones. This issue won us an Addy Award.
Menu Magazine, Fall 2005 Issue
The fall issue honored the season with quick meals that were “hearty, not heavy”. I wanted convey warmth and comfort with a deep, rich color palette, leaf imprint, and a patina effect to add to the rustic, earthy quality.
Menu Magazine, Summer 2005 Issue
The Chesapeake feature introduced customers to the growers they partner with for the freshest, best quality shellfish in the region. These generational family-run businesses are steeped in the history of the Chesapeake, and I wanted to reflect that through duotone photography and a classic typeface in a coastal blue color.
